Problems solved by technology

However, there are very few face detection applications at the entrances of public and entertainment venues. There may be many reasons for this. Considering the technical dimension of face detection alone, the camera is set up at the entrance facing the gate, and there is a strong backlight environment during the day. , it is very difficult to detect faces; the posture of a face in the monitoring area is uncertain, and it is necessary to select an image output that is most suitable for recognition. The general method will have a large amount of calculation, and it is difficult to guarantee high-performance processing equipment. Real-time, if the performance or quantity of processing equipment is increased to solve real-time problems, the hardware cost of the entire system will be increased

Embodiment Construction

[0039] Such as figure 1 As shown, the face detection method in a backlight environment described in the embodiment of the present invention comprises the following steps:

[0040] 1) According to the lighting conditions, dynamically adjust the parameters of the camera to obtain images that are more suitable for face detection.

[0041] Now the cameras for face detection are generally high-definition network cameras, and their default parameters are adapted to the uniform lighting environment. If the default or a certain fixed parameter is still used in the backlight environment, the face detection rate will be reduced and the final result will be face image quality. Today's network cameras not only obtain images through the network, but also set camera parameters in real time by calling the camera SDK. Therefore, the method of dynamically adjusting camera parameters through algorithms is still very applicable.

Abstract

The invention relates to a face detection method in a backlight environment, comprising the following steps: dynamically adjusting camera parameters; foreground and background segmentation; face positioning; face tracking and storage; face image size filtering; face image definition filtering ; Frontal face filtering; Face image output. The beneficial effects of the present invention are as follows: adjust the dynamic parameters of the camera to adapt to face detection under different lighting environments, so that better face images can be obtained in backlight environments; a series of simplified face detection methods are designed for backlight environments , the detection effect is good, and at the same time, the resources occupied by CPU processing are greatly reduced, so that the hardware cost of the entire system can be reduced.

technical field [0001] The invention relates to a face detection method in a backlight environment. Background technique [0002] With the rapid growth of my country's economy, people's living and material standards have been greatly improved, and people are paying more and more attention to their personal and property safety. At the same time, the rapid economic development accompanied by a sharp increase in urban floating population has added new problems to urban social security. Because most of the traditional security monitoring is just recording video, processing and collecting evidence after the event, it is difficult to prevent the occurrence of potential safety hazards. Therefore, the development of intelligent security monitoring systems has become an inevitable trend in the current construction of safe cities and smart cities.
